Customer engagement is more than just a buzzword.

It is the emotional connection and continued relationship a customer has with your brand. It’s the sum of all interactions - from their first website visit to a post-purchase support call. In an economy where loyalty drives long-term success, learning how to improve customer engagement may be the most critical investment a business can make for long-term and sustainable growth.

10 Ways to Improve Customer Engagement

A strong customer engagement strategy is the foundation of a successful company. Businesses that focus on engagement are more profitable, as an engaged customer represents an average 23% premium in terms of share of revenue compared to the average customer. In addition, companies that actively work to improve customer engagement can increase cross-sell revenue by 22% and drive a higher annual increase in customer retention.

Here are 10 ways you can improve customer engagement and build customer relationships that drive this level of success:

1. Personalize Customer Engagements

You need to move beyond generic messaging and use customer data to personalize your communications, recommendations, and offers to customers based on their specific needs and past behaviors.

2. Better Understand Your Customers

Knowledge is half the battle. Develop detailed customer personas and map the customer journey to gain better insight into customer motivations, pain points, and expectations at every touchpoint.

3. Create a Brand Narrative

Your customer engagement must go beyond just selling a product or providing a service. You need to build an authentic brand story and mission that customers can connect with on an emotional level.

4. Simplify Communication with Self-Service Options

Self-service tools like FAQs and chatbots are vital, as their true value lies in enhancing communication by giving customers 24/7 access to answers. This clear and immediate communication builds trust and reduces friction.

5. Create Customer Loyalty Programs

It is important for successful companies to reward repeat business with exclusive perks, discounts, or early access to new products. This makes customers feel valued and gives them a great reason to remain loyal to your company.

6. Establish Clear Goals for Customer Engagement

What does a successful customer engagement strategy look like? Define what success looks like by setting measurable KPIs - such as retention rates, repeat purchase frequency, or Net Promoter Score (NPS) - to track your progress.

7. Employ a Social Media Marketing Campaign

A majority of your customers likely use social media. Use social platforms not just to promote your products and services, but to interact and engage with customers by running engaging contests, asking questions, and actively responding to comments and messages.

8. Engage with Customers Where They Are Most Active

Don't force customers to come to you. It is important that your business be present and accessible on the channels that your customers already use - whether that's email, SMS, social media, or a mobile application.

9. Encourage Customer Feedback

Customer feedback can help you better understand the customer experience and make key adjustments. Actively ask for your customers' opinions through surveys, polls, and review prompts at key touchpoints, showing them that you value their voice.

10. Collect and Analyze Customer Feedback Data

Customer feedback is only a part of the equation. You need to be able to use the data provided by customer feedback. Use a customer experience management platform to gather all your feedback in one place, allowing you to analyze trends, identify recurring issues, and make data-driven decisions.
